Who did you see in the reflection, and how are the minds configured?

Hotaru's face and body; your mind is in full control

You blinked rapidly, thinking you were seeing some sort of illusion or prank at first, or that the reflection was angled funny from the surface of the lamp such that you were seeing someone next to you instead of who you were. But, when you widened your eyes and saw the reflection instantly reciprocate, you instantly realized that you were in Hotaru's body.

At least, that was your best assumption. You couldn't move your neck to look down, not yet. Nothing felt like it worked, other than your eyelids. Had the phase binding paralyzed you in the process? You glanced to the side a little, seeing your boss and coworkers, along with Toshiko standing off to the side, watching you like a hawk. She seemed just as concerned about the outcome as you did... and she tapped Harry's side when she saw your eyes open.

Harry turned to you, to give you a quick examination. "Ah, there we go. Okay, so... don't worry, we've put some neural limiters on your body for temporary paralysis, just so we could sort things out before you could run out of the room screaming. I'm going to remove the one at your jaw and neck so you'll be able to move your whole head, but don't strain yourself, it would be easy to hurt yourself with a sudden movement."

Your supervisor reached over and removed these little pads from your chin and neck, and suddenly you had feeling in them again! You could feel the heat from the lamp on your skin, and you could feel your tongue running along your teeth on the inside of your mouth. But the sensation reminded you of going to the dentist and getting a filling in a tooth, where then your tooth would feel wrong every time your tongue touched it. It was like that, but... for your whole mouth. Everything was strangely different.

You squinted as you looked up at Harry. "What the hell did you do to me..?!"

One of your colleagues, Teresa, wrote something down on a clipboard. "No accent when speaking English. So Wayne's mind is at least functioning to some degree."

"Yeah, but it's functioning from within someone else!"

More scribbling on a clipboard, before Teresa steps closer. "Okay, and now Hotaru, can you say something to us? How about a little Japanese?"

You stared up Teresa like she was mad, as nothing else happened. Silence fell over the room, before enough time had passed to confirm that Hotaru was either unwilling or unable to speak independently. "You expected our minds to be active at the same time or something? What's going on already!" Still no accent, still all you.

"Alright, alright, calm down Wayne," Harry said, before motioning over Toshiko. "Next test. Toshiko, if you would please."

You bit your lip a little, staring up at this girl who for whatever reason seemed to fear approaching you. It must be because she was looking at Hotaru's face the whole time, and Hotaru berated Toshiko more than anyone else at the company. You didn't like seeing her afraid of you... you relaxed a little, hoping to not scare her off with a scowl. Toshiko said a few phrases in Japanese, so quickly and fluidly that you couldn't keep up with anything she said. You heard a few words you recognized, mostly from high school Japanese classes you took years ago, but you stared at her blankly when she stopped.

"Sorry, uh... what was that?" you said.

Toshiko put a hand to her mouth as she stared down at you. "It really is just Wayne as an active mind, isn't it? What did you think about Killer Lizards From Venus?"

"Great acting, good monsters, but I totally saw the plot twist from a mile away that the lizards were actually the other space crew that landed on Venus in the first place."

Toshiko's face brightened as she looked down at you. "Amazing... I agree, it was so obvious!"

You chatted with Toshiko for a little bit, at least to ease your mind, as others took some vitals and checked your body. She was the best distraction you could ask for, as her cute smile and extensive knowledge of classic monster movies always captured your attention without fail. For at least a brief amount of time, you'd forgotten that you were speaking through someone else's mouth, with someone else's face, stealing their appearance as your own.

Eventually, Toshiko had to get back to work, and when she was gone, reality sunk in again. You turned to Harry. "Could you please tell me why you put me and Hotaru in the phase binder now?" It was strange to hear someone else's voice escape, but it didn't sound like Hotaru either. You spoke softly and calmly this time, something you'd never heard Hotaru do unless she was flirting with someone to get something she wanted at work.

"This was easy math, Wayne," Harry said. "We looked back at the amount of time it took to assess the last acquisition, that Korean lab. That was weeks of untangling technical topics across two languages where we had take some risks based on translations that missed the mark. We needed someone who both had the translation and technical capabilities all in one, and it would take too long to train you on a new language and to train Hotaru on the technical side of what we need evaluated. The Phase Binder is being explored as an option, as you can see. Don't worry, we can undo it later, but this experiment comes from the top to see if we can fix the barrier between the technical and translation work for future company buyouts."

"Why didn't you consult me first? And how in the hell does Shaw have some scrapped Yabusa tech anyway?"

"Forgiveness versus permission, Wayne, that's all it is. You should know better how Shaw Sciences works by now, huh? Dr. Shaw's always been ready-fire-aim, and usually omits the ready part as well. As for the Phase Binder, well I don't know, but we've got it. And we're gonna use it, as you've found out."

"Can't you just put me back to normal now?" you asked, a pleading look in your eyes. "This feels weird enough as it is, everyone looks at me differently, nothing feels or sounds right and that's all just from the head so far. You'd already seen I can't speak Japanese, so it seems like this is a failure."

Harry shook his head. "Not exactly, not yet. The Phase Binder team thought this might happen, with how they connected your brain to Hotaru's with the phase tech. It's not woven together, it's more like with the phases it's kinda layered, I guess. They think you'll start making new synaptic pathways in the language center of the brain really quick with a bit of immersion into things that might remind Hotaru of stuff. Though, it's a delicate dance--if we push you too far, Hotaru's whole mind might just light up and override you, and then we've got a girl who probably won't know anything about the chemicals and materials we need, back in control of herself, while you're a passenger fighting for control. That doesn't do us any good. We specifically tried to make sure your personality was at the fore, because people like you, pal. But Hotaru's personality is right under the surface, and too big of a push could make her bubble up and then who knows how easy it would be to claw your way back. That part of her brain is more phased out than yours, so avoid that catastrophic failure and I think you'll be set."

You frowned. "This sounds like a bad idea. If I'm the one people want in control, why not just use my body? Where even is it right now?"

"Oh, it's phased out." Harry picked up a little pamphlet titled 'Phase Binding And You', holding up the graphics for you to see. "Basically, Hotaru's body is at normal phase, yours is at the opposite phase so it's not visible. And the phasing in your brains are strategically interleaved to, hopefully, give you Hotaru's memories and skills and language while keeping you in control. We could've done it the way you said, but Dr. Shaw thinks that a pretty lady will make the people over in the Hiroshima lab way more agreeable to what you have to say, as long as you can do it without Hotaru's pushiness."

You sighed, and looked upward. "This is absurd..."

"It sure is," Harry said, patting your shoulder--at least, you thought he did, you couldn't feel it yet. When he removed the limiter that had been placed on the shoulder, sensation flooded into you once more, no longer feeling totally numb. "So, in order for you to acclimate, we're gonna remove these limiters, and we'll give you most of the rest of the day to just... get to know yourself. I don't care what that entails, neither does the medical staff, they're being instructed to knock before entering this little observation room before you let them in. If you feel like there's some medical problem, or you feel like Hotaru's personality is about to take charge, you've got a panic button by the bed. Otherwise... get used to things, and then we'll talk some more logistics by five. And don't bother asking to end this experiment, Dr. Shaw personally has said things are to continue so long as your personality is present. So, you're not getting out of this one just because it's weird."

You sighed. You really should start looking for a new job... you wonder if Hideki Labs had any open positions.

Harry removed the limiters from head to toe, as feeling started to surge through your body, like it was finally waking up. Without another word, he vanished out the door, closing it behind you, leaving you totally alone.
